Patient-Controlled Analgesia
A method allowing patients to self-administer a controlled amount of pain medication through a device, under medical supervision.
Intraspinal Analgesia
A method of relieving pain by delivering analgesic medication directly into the spinal canal.
Epidural
A form of anesthesia involving an injection into the space around the spinal cord, commonly used during childbirth and certain types of surgery.
Local Infusion Pump
A device used to deliver medications and other fluids directly into a localized area of the body at controlled rates.
